GE VMIVME5576 32-channel optical isolation digital output board (VME bus)
I. Basic Information
Brand: GE Fanuc (formerly VMIC, now Abaco Systems)
Model: VMIVME5576
Bus standard: VMEbus Rev.C.1, double-height Eurocard industrial card specification
Product positioning: 32-channel optically isolated digital output board card, dedicated DO control card for VME architecture control system, used to issue interlock, trip, equipment start-stop and other switch control instructions, often paired with VMIVME-1150 (DI acquisition card) for GE Mark V/VI turbine generator set turbine control system.

Core Hardware Parameters
1. Channel Configuration
Total 32 independent optically isolated digital outputs, divided into 4 groups × 8 channels registers, supporting 8/16-bit VME bus read/write
Output Type: Open collector, supports pull current / sink current two wiring modes
Output Current Options: 2.5mA (low current), 300mA (high-power drive)
External Power Supply Range: DC 5V~30V, requires external pull-up power supply to achieve electrical isolation
2. Electrical Isolation Performance
Single-channel optocoupler continuous withstand voltage: 1000V AC, pulse withstand voltage up to 6000V
Channel-to-channel isolation withstand voltage: 500V AC, completely eliminates ground loop interference and industrial strong power surge damage to VME main control backplane
3. Bus and Hardware Specifications
Built-in DIP switch: 14-bit VME base address setting, supports privileged / non-privileged I/O access
Supports 8-bit, 16-bit two VME data transmission modes
Power Supply: Backplane + 5V DC power supply
External Interface: Front and rear dual 64-pin DIN connectors, front output terminals for wiring

Main Functional Features
32-channel batch switch quantity control output
Issue control signals for electromagnetic valves, trip relays, cooling fans, circuit breaker closing, sound and light alarms, local equipment start-stop control, which is the core output card of the unit safety interlock circuit.
Output Polarity Flexible Configuration
On-board jumpers can set positive logic / negative logic output, compatible with NPN, PNP external relay circuits, compatible with 24V DC control circuit standards of power plants.
Strong Electromagnetic Isolation Protection
Each independent optocoupler isolation, faults and short circuits on the site side will not reverse breakdown the VME main control CPU board, suitable for fire power, gas turbine strong interference cabinet environment.
Flexible Hardware Addressing

Typical Application Scenarios
GE Mark V / Mark VI turbine generator set TSI, ETS trip protection system
Output protection instructions for unit tripping, high and low pressure bypass, excitation tripping, auxiliary machine interlock, etc.
Large compressors, gas turbines, power station excitation VME distributed control system.
Industrial embedded test platform, rail transit, military data acquisition control equipment.
